Here's the problem.
1. No #1 that dropped their last game has not made the playoff. Yet Georgia is probably out.
2. No UNDEFEATED conference champ has EVER been kept out of the CFP
3. Bama beat the #1 team in the country but no team ranked outside the top 6 has ever made the CFP. Bama is a one loss conference champ.
4. Texas beat Bama in Tuscaloosa like a drum. A loss is a loss doesn't matter when it happened. Texas is a one loss conference champ that won the head to head against another conference champ.
